Bugs in busybusy SaaS gefunden

busybusy

busybusy ist eine benutzerfreundliche App, die Aufsichtspersonen mit GPS-Zeiterfassung und Auftragskostenerfassung ausstattet und so eine effiziente Überwachung von Bautrupps ermöglicht.

Sie bietet eine breite Palette von Funktionen, einschließlich unbegrenzter Fotospeicherung, umfassender Auftragskalkulation, täglicher Bauberichte, Dokumentenmanagement und Fortschrittsverfolgung in Echtzeit. Sie können mühelos den Aufenthaltsort Ihres Teams, den Status der Ausrüstung und laufende Projekte überwachen. Mit zusätzlichen Funktionen wie GPS-Einblicken in die Ausrüstung, Bedienerdetails und Echtzeitstatistiken zum Kraftstoffverbrauch und Serviceberichten ist busybusy das ideale Tool zur Maximierung der Produktivität.

Unsere QA-Ingenieure haben beschlossen, die Leistung von busybusy SaaS manuell zu testen. Hier sind einige der auffälligsten busybusy-Fehler, die wir gefunden haben.

Die Seite öffnet sich nicht, wenn Sie auf die Schaltfläche "Auf Twitter teilen" klicken

Die Strenge:

Kritisch

Wiedergabeschritte:
  1. Klicken Sie auf den Menüpunkt “Free Time Clock Calculator”, der sich am unteren Rand der Seite befindet.
  2. Klicken Sie auf das Twitter-Symbol.
Der Umgebung:

Google Chrome Version 114.0.5735.199
Microsoft Edge Version 114.0.1823.79
Firefox 115.0.2

Tatsächliche Ergebnis:

Die Seite “Twitter” wird nicht geöffnet.

Erwartetes Ergebnis:

Der Benutzer sollte in der Lage sein, die Beiträge erfolgreich auf Twitter zu teilen.

"401-Fehler" erscheint nach dem Erstellen eines Kontos mit verschiedenen Werten im Feld "Passwort bestätigen"

Die Strenge:

Schwerwiegend

Wiedergabeschritte:
  1. Füllen Sie die Felder “Firmenname” und “E-Mail” aus.
  2. Geben Sie ein gültiges Passwort (mindestens 8 Zeichen) in das Feld “Passwort” ein.
  3. Geben Sie in das Feld “Passwort bestätigen” ein anderes Passwort ein (das nicht mit dem Wert in “Passwort” übereinstimmt).
  4. Klicken Sie auf die Schaltfläche “Konto erstellen”.
Der Umgebung:

Google Chrome Version 114.0.5735.199
Microsoft Edge Version 114.0.1823.79
Firefox 115.0.2

Tatsächliche Ergebnis:

Nachdem Sie auf die Schaltfläche “Konto erstellen” geklickt haben, erhalten Sie keine Antwort; es werden keine Validierungsmeldungen angezeigt; in der Konsole der Entwicklertools wird ein “401-Fehler” angezeigt.

Erwartetes Ergebnis:

Die Validierungsmeldung für ein ungültiges Kennwort sollte angezeigt werden.

Endless loading spinner erscheint auf der Registerkarte "Expanded" unter der Tabelle

Die Strenge:

Schwerwiegend

Voraussetzungen:
  1. Der Benutzer ist in der App angemeldet.
  2. Es gibt keine Einträge auf der Registerkarte “Erweitert”.
Wiedergabeschritte:
  1. Erweitern Sie die Registerkarte “Zeitkarten”.
  2. Klicken Sie auf die Registerkarte “Zusammenfassung”.
  3. Wechseln Sie auf die Registerkarte “Erweitert”.
Der Umgebung:

Google Chrome Version 114.0.5735.199
Microsoft Edge Version 114.0.1823.79
Firefox 115.0.2

Tatsächliche Ergebnis:

Auf dem Bildschirm erscheint der endlose Ladekreisel.

Erwartetes Ergebnis:

Die Meldung “Keine Zeiteinträge im angegebenen Datumsbereich” sollte auf den entsprechenden Registerkarten in gleicher Weise angezeigt werden.

Endless loading spinner erscheint auf der Registerkarte

Endless Parsing Spinner erscheint auf der Registerkarte "Mitarbeiter" beim Massenimport einer beschädigten Datei

Die Strenge:

Schwerwiegend

Voraussetzungen:
  1. Der Benutzer ist bei der Anwendung angemeldet.
  2. Die vorbereitete beschädigte Testdatei (import_test.xlsx) ist in den Anhängen enthalten.
Wiedergabeschritte:
  1. Gehen Sie auf die Registerkarte “Mitarbeiter”.
  2. Klicken Sie auf die Schaltfläche “Erstellen”.
  3. Blättern Sie im Formular “Neuen Mitarbeiter erstellen” nach unten.
  4. Klicken Sie auf den Link “Massenimport versuchen”.
  5. Laden Sie die beschädigte Datei hoch.
Der Umgebung:

Google Chrome Version 114.0.5735.199
Microsoft Edge Version 114.0.1823.79
Firefox 115.0.2

Tatsächliche Ergebnis:

Die Fehlermeldung für ein ungültiges Dateiformat wird angezeigt, zusammen mit dem endlosen Parsing-Spinner. Der Parsing-Spinner wird auch nach dem Schließen des Modalfensters “Neuen Mitarbeiter erstellen” weiterhin angezeigt.

Erwartetes Ergebnis:

Der Endlos-Parsing-Spinner sollte nicht mehr angezeigt werden, nachdem dem Benutzer die Fehlermeldung angezeigt wurde.

Endless Parsing Spinner erscheint auf der Registerkarte
Endless Parsing Spinner erscheint auf der Registerkarte

Benutzer kann eine nicht existierende E-Mail im Formular "Passwort vergessen" eingeben

Die Strenge:

Schwerwiegend

Voraussetzungen:

Der Benutzer befindet sich auf der Hauptseite der Anwendung.

Wiedergabeschritte:
  1. Wählen Sie den Menüpunkt “Anmelden”.
  2. Klicken Sie auf den Link “Benutzernamen oder Passwort vergessen”.
  3. Geben Sie eine nicht existierende E-Mail in das Eingabefeld E-Mail ein.
  4. Klicken Sie auf die Schaltfläche “Absenden”.
Der Umgebung:

Google Chrome Version 114.0.5735.199
Microsoft Edge Version 114.0.1823.79
Firefox 115.0.2

Tatsächliche Ergebnis:

Es wird keine Bestätigungsmeldung für eine nicht erkannte E-Mail-Adresse angezeigt.

Erwartetes Ergebnis:

Nach dem Klicken auf die Schaltfläche “Absenden” sollte die Validierungsmeldung über eine im System nicht erkannte E-Mail-Adresse angezeigt werden.

Das Feld "Handy" wird im Formular "Demo planen" nicht validiert

Die Strenge:

Geringfügig

Voraussetzungen:

Der Benutzer befindet sich auf der Seite “Demo planen” (https://busybusy.com/schedule-demo/).

Wiedergabeschritte:
  1. Wählen Sie ein verfügbares Datum und eine Uhrzeit.
  2. Klicken Sie auf die Schaltfläche “Weiter”.
  3. Füllen Sie alle erforderlichen Felder aus, mit Ausnahme des Feldes “Mobiltelefon”.
  4. Geben Sie Buchstaben in das Feld “Mobiltelefon” ein.
  5. Klicken Sie auf die Schaltfläche “Ereignis planen”.
Der Umgebung:

Google Chrome Version 114.0.5735.199
Microsoft Edge Version 114.0.1823.79
Firefox 115.0.2

Tatsächliche Ergebnis:

Das Ereignis wurde erfolgreich geplant; es wird keine Bestätigungsmeldung für ungültige Daten im Feld “Mobiltelefon” angezeigt.

Erwartetes Ergebnis:

Die Überprüfungsmeldung für das Feld “Mobiltelefon” sollte angezeigt werden.

Während der Tests stieß ich auf Probleme im Zusammenhang mit der Integration mit anderen Systemen und beobachtete ein unerwartetes Verhalten des Systems, wenn es nicht auf Benutzereingaben reagierte. Ich war in der Lage, Fehler in den Entwicklertools zu identifizieren. Ich empfehle eine gründliche Überprüfung der bestehenden Funktionalität und die Implementierung geeigneter Validierungsregeln.
Tetiana, QA-Ingenieurin

Tetiana, QA-Ingenieurin

Benötigen Sie einen zuverlässigen QS-Partner?

Engagieren Sie uns